Every age, from young children who need an early evaluation to teens ready for braces or Invisalign to adults who decided this is finally their year. Orthodontics isn’t only for kids, and it’s never too late to start.
For younger patients, early treatment can guide jaw growth and make room for permanent teeth, which sometimes makes later treatment simpler. For teens and adults, we offer discreet options that fit busy, active lives.

Dr. John earned her dental degree at the University of California San Francisco, graduating second in her class in the International Dental Program, and completed her orthodontic certificate and a Master of Science in Dentistry at the University of Detroit Mercy.
She’s an active member of the American Board of Orthodontics, the American Association of Orthodontists, and the South Florida Association of Orthodontists. She also speaks English, Portuguese, and Spanish, so more families in our community feel understood and comfortable. How old should my child be for a first orthodontic visit?
The American Association of Orthodontists suggests a first evaluation around age 7. That doesn’t mean treatment starts then, but it lets us catch anything worth watching early.
